Begin Record
When the image database fills completely, recording stops and the unit displays a
message. Use this option to start recording again at the beginning of the image
database.
This option is only available when:
• The system is configured for linear mode operation (see Record Mode Option on
page 133), and:
•The Begin recording later option was selected from the full database notification
screen.
NOTE: The Begin Record option is a protected feature. You must possess the
Record Enable privilege to access it (see Security Option on page 127).
To begin recording again:
1. From the main screen, click the Utility button. The Utility Options screen appears.
2. Click Begin Record.
3. If the image database has not been archived, select Yes and click OK to start
recording again (and return to the Utility Options screen), or select No and click
OK to cancel the operation and return to the Utility Options screen.
4. If the image database has been archived, select Yes and click OK to start recording
again (and return to the Utility Options screen), or select No and click OK to cancel
the operation and return to the Utility Options screen.
Activity Log
The Activity Log feature provides a record of all activity performed on the Intellex
unit after a user has logged in. An activity is defined as any action that a user
performs on the unit or via Network Client. The log lists user name, date/time the
activity occurred, the access location (on the local unit or via Network Client), the
Category of activity, and the activity that occurred according to that Category’s menu
options.
The log can be printed and sorted using the filters selected in the Activity Filter area.
If the Activity Log exceeds its maximum size of 20,0000 items (about 30 days of
activity), the oldest stored data is overwritten by the newest incoming data.
